    The Core i7-860 is manufactured by Intel. It was released in 8 September 2009 (16 years ago). It is based on the Lynnfield (2009−2010) architecture. It features 4 cores and 8 threads. Base frequency is 2.8 GHz, with boost up to 3.46 GHz. L3 cache: 8 MB (total). L2 cache: 256 kB (per core). Built on 45 nm process technology. Socket: LGA1156. Thermal design power (TDP): 95 Watt. Memory support: DDR3. Passmark benchmark score: 3,011 points. Launch price was $229.

    Processing Power

    The Athlon X4 830 packs 4 cores / 4 threads, matching the Core i7-860's 4 cores. Boost clocks reach 3.4 GHz on the Athlon X4 830 versus 3.46 GHz on the Core i7-860 — a 1.7% clock advantage for the Core i7-860 (base: 3 GHz vs 2.8 GHz). The Athlon X4 830 uses the Kaveri (2014−2015) architecture (28 nm), while the Core i7-860 uses Lynnfield (2009−2010) (45 nm). In PassMark, the Athlon X4 830 scores 3,018 against the Core i7-860's 3,011 — a 0.2% lead for the Athlon X4 830.
